For brain structure, so much of the literature is 'size' (volume/thickness/area), but glosses over what shape the volume is.
About 10 years ago I came across 'fractal dimensionality' as a measure of brain structure. Studying it's utility with healthy aging, clinical populations, and across species has led to 19 papers since then. The most recent paper is now online at Nature Neuroscience!
